MODEL: MEX-F MEX-F SPECIFICATIONS ES-4623 Rev.7 Page 1/5 http://www.m-system.co.jp/ Final Control Elements VALVE POSITIONER Functions & Features
- I/I positioner for proportional valve position control in combination with electric actuator (100 V AC)
- Driving directly AC motor by solid state relay output
- Potentiometer or current feedback selectable
- Timer preventing frequent ON-OFF operation, protecting motor from overheating
- Retransmitted output standard Typical Applications
- Single phase AC motor

- SSR: Zero-cross fucntion; 80 – 264 V AC @ 0.1 – 1 A The built-in SSR cannot drive 200 V AC motor (direct/reverse). Leakage current at OFF: Approx. 10 mA @ 240 V Remark: When driving relays with this control output, relays may operate erratically due to the leakage current at OFF of SSR. To avoid the problem, install a resistor (R) in parallel with the relay coil. R < [Release Voltage] / ([Leakage Current at OFF] – [Release Current]) Output Operation: Refer to the figure at the end of this section. ■ Constant Current Rating: 10 V DC, 10 mA ±10 % at ON; 0 mA at OFF Output Operation: Refer to the figure at the end of this section.

Specify "Operation Mode Selector" type (code 1) when ordering, if changing out- put action to "Direct". EXPLANATIONS OF TERMS
- SSR (Solid State Relay) Composed only of semiconductor parts, SSR is free from arc discharge or chattering which is typical with electromagnetic relays. It features excellent characteristics against vibration, physical impact or other environmental conditions.
- Zero-Cross Function SSR with zero-cross function turns on when AC power voltage is near zero, creating delay of switching when input is provided in the middle of an wave cycle, thus limiting transient switching noise voltage and rush current.
- Photo MOSFET Relay A kind of semiconductor relay which has advantages of both solid state relay and mechanical relay, thanks to its low ON- resistance characteristic. It also features high speed ON/OFF operation and low leak current. Specifications are subject to change without notice.
